#f07368 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f07368 is composed of 94.1% red, 45.1%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.1% magenta, 56.7%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 4.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 67.5%. #f07368 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6d0 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

● #f07368 color description : Soft red.
The hexadecimal color #f07368 has RGB values of R:240, G:115,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.57,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15758184.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0201 is the darkest color, while #fef7f7 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0a9a8 is the less saturated color, while #fd685b is the most saturated one.
